Output e8bed96e4de5a9632f8ac33efd784ea36ec2e94a40c84c1a1cdbf9a63da74e86:0

value
1338120
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cffb35d4a668a80ac3321a8a11d9db4b8a1ce61f OP_EQUAL
address
3LeijeaEGuzF5y7RxTWQbYmduLDvkaZBQY
transaction
e8bed96e4de5a9632f8ac33efd784ea36ec2e94a40c84c1a1cdbf9a63da74e86
confirmations
91032
spent
true